Job Summary:

This role is identified specifically for growth within WEST's Environmental Planning, Permitting, and Assessment group. The person selected for this role will be an experienced project manager that has documented success leading large-scale energy projects and developing NEPA documents (e.g., Environmental Impact Statements and/or Environmental Assessments). The job will involve managing projects, assembling and managing multidisciplinary teams, and navigating project development from pre-construction surveys through agency coordination and permitting.

As part of a growing team, this role will also have an emphasis on mentoring deputy project managers and staff newer to environmental consulting.

Ideal candidates will have a minimum of a bachelor's degree and 7+ years of experience in environmental consulting as a project manager, with several years of conducting project reviews under NEPA. Although the selected candidate may work on projects throughout the US, depending on experience, preference will be given to candidates with experience working with the Bureau of Land Management, Department of Energy, US Fish and Wildlife Service, US Forest Service, and/or Federal Energy Regulatory Commission.

Responsibilities include:

The selected candidate will work with a team of environmental planners, natural resource specialists, scientists, and GIS specialists on the following:

  • Complete and direct various project management and support tasks related to project siting evaluation, environmental planning, or environmental reviews (e.g., federal/state/local site permitting and environmental reviews, wetland and/or water resource permitting, environmental site assessments).
  • Coordinate and manage natural resource field studies (e.g., wildlife, wetlands).
  • Direct multi-disciplinary teams (including internal staff and external sub consultants) in completing environmental review for small, medium, and large-scale energy projects.
  • Coordinate with local/state/federal agencies, tribes, and stakeholders in support of client-directed project work.
  • Collaborate closely with clients to support real-time requests and help clients implement scientific consulting solutions. Take lead on navigating the regulatory landscape and providing clients with novel and innovative solutions.
  • Review reports, applying expertise to present and interpret the results of field and desktop studies in their scientific and regulatory context.
  • Ensure team alignment on field data management and GIS data processes to meet WEST standards and client/agency requirements.
  • Market WEST's capabilities, respond to proposal requests, and provide oversight into the development of scopes of work and budget estimates.
  • Foster current business relationships and promote new business development efforts.
  • Help maintain WEST's position as thought leaders in the environmental consulting market.
  • Supervision/Mentorship:
    • Manage project teams, deliverables, and budgets for multiple projects
    • Mentor deputy project managers
  • This position will require overnight travel
